Transaction 29f515825359e60ed094ba96f36f43786ebdb6e15d7cb5cf11983b5a565709e8

1 Input
2 Outputs
  • 29f515825359e60ed094ba96f36f43786ebdb6e15d7cb5cf11983b5a565709e8:0
  • value  100015
    address  3Mt2DQ41TXhcJ14dyyhEvdntYb8n9TNLWe
  • 29f515825359e60ed094ba96f36f43786ebdb6e15d7cb5cf11983b5a565709e8:1
  • value  1996100
    address  39PuJTh3NLLYea3g28bHfN5G2sPxTfiyhD